臨床ガイドラインに基づき処方箋の妥当性を自動審査し、潜在的な薬物相互作用や禁忌を特定し、標準化された審査レポートを生成します。

プロンプト内容 コピー コピー

Act as a senior clinical pharmacist to review the provided patient prescription for compliance. First, extract the drug name, dosage, route of administration, and frequency from the prescription, and cross-reference them with the patient's diagnosis, allergy history, and liver/kidney function indicators. Focus on identifying incompatibilities, overdosage, or violations of administration time windows. If potential risks are found, provide specific adjustment suggestions or alternative plans based on the latest clinical medication guidelines, along with the rationale. Finally, generate a structured audit summary listing all potential risk points and corresponding handling suggestions to ensure medication safety and adherence to medical standards.

熟練した臨床薬剤師として、提供された患者の処方箋が規則に準拠しているか審査してください。まず、処方箋から薬剤名、用量、投与経路、頻度を抽出し、患者の診断、アレルギー歴、肝腎機能指標と照合します。互換性の欠如、過量投与、または投与時間枠の違反がないか重点的に確認します。潜在的なリスクが見つかった場合は、最新の臨床投薬ガイドラインに基づき、具体的な調整提案または代替案とその理由を提供してください。最後に、すべての潜在的なリスクポイントと対応する処理提案をリストアップした構造化された審査サマリーを生成し、医薬品の安全性と医療基準の遵守を確保してください。

処方審査アシスタント
Act as a senior clinical pharmacist and review the following prescription according to the latest clinical medication guidelines: The patient is a 65-year-old male diagnosed with type 2 diabetes and mild renal insufficiency (eGFR 45ml/min). The current prescription includes metformin, glimepiride, and aspirin. Focus on evaluating the necessity of dose adjustment for metformin in the context of renal insufficiency, analyze the hypoglycemia risk associated with glimepiride, and check for potential interactions between aspirin and anticoagulants. Finally, provide specific dosage adjustment recommendations or alternative drug suggestions to ensure the safety and efficacy of the medication regimen.
